### **Increasing Prevalence of Cardiovascular Diseases**

The United States has witnessed a significant rise in cardiovascular diseases, leading to a greater demand for cardiac mapping solutions. According to the American Heart Association, approximately 697,000 Americans died from heart disease in 2020, which accounts for about one in every five deaths.

This growing prevalence necessitates advanced diagnostic tools like cardiac mapping systems to support healthcare professionals in identifying and treating arrhythmias.

Major organizations such as **Medtronic** and Abbott Laboratories have actively contributed to the development of innovative cardiac mapping technologies, enhancing patient outcomes in the rapidly expanding US Cardiac Mapping Market Industry.

The rising incidence of heart diseases drives the demand for effective mapping solutions, thereby contributing to market growth and highlighting the need for continued investments in this sector.

### **Growing Geriatric Population in the US**

The geriatric population in the United States is rapidly increasing, which directly correlates with the rising demand for cardiac mapping solutions. According to the U.S. Census Bureau, the population aged 65 and older is projected to reach 80 million by 2040.

This demographic is particularly vulnerable to cardiovascular diseases, leading to higher rates of arrhythmias and related conditions. As a result, healthcare providers are increasingly turning to cardiac mapping technologies to cater to this aging population's needs.

Companies like **Philips** and Siemens Healthineers are focusing on creating user-friendly cardiac mapping solutions that can be easily implemented in various healthcare facilities, thereby enhancing patient care.

The growing geriatric segment emphasizes the urgent need for improved cardiac monitoring and mapping solutions, fueling the US Cardiac Mapping Market's growth.

### **Cardiac Mapping Market Technology Insights**

The US Cardiac Mapping Market, particularly within the Technology segment, has experienced substantial advancements, contributing significantly to the overall growth and innovation in the healthcare sector. This segment encompasses several methodologies, each catering to specific healthcare needs and providing unique advantages in diagnostics and treatment.

Among the various technologies, [**Electrophysiology**](../../../reports/electrophysiology-market-11849)Mapping stands out for its efficacy in diagnosing arrhythmias. By utilizing advanced electrical activities of the heart, this technology enables practitioners to pinpoint regions responsible for irregular heartbeats, thus facilitating precise therapeutic interventions and improving patient outcomes.

Magnetic Mapping is another vital technology, known for its non-invasive approach in visualizing cardiac structures. It leverages magnetic fields, providing comprehensive insights into the heart's electrical signals, which enhances pre-operative planning and post-operative assessments, reinforcing its role in cardiac interventions.

Meanwhile, Optical Mapping offers innovative techniques by employing fluorescence and high-resolution imaging. It allows researchers and clinicians to observe cardiac activities at a cellular level, unveiling detailed information about the heart's electrophysiological properties that traditional methods might overlook.

Lastly, Catheter-based Mapping plays a crucial role in the practical application of cardiac mapping technologies. Its ability to navigate through the vasculature, collect data directly from the heart, and provide real-time feedback is a game-changer in cardiology, making it an essential tool for both diagnosis and therapeutic delivery.

### **CardioFocus**

CardioFocus represents another influential player in the US Cardiac Mapping Market, focusing on providing advanced technologies for the treatment of atrial fibrillation. The company is well-known for its innovative products, including a unique catheter system that utilizes laser energy to create lesions and isolate problematic cardiac tissue.

This targeted approach not only improves the accuracy of cardiac mapping but also enhances procedural outcomes for patients. With a strong focus on developing and refining its technologies, CardioFocus has established a solid market presence in the US by collaborating with leading hospitals and healthcare institutions.
